Superman: Cavillā€™s Heroic Portrayal in the Snyderverse

Henry Cavill shot to international fame when he donned the iconic red cape as Superman in Zack Snyderā€™s Man of Steel (2013). His portrayal of the legendary Kryptonian was met with praise for his physicality, intensity, and emotional depth. Cavill brought a grounded, complex version of Superman to life, standing out in a genre that is often critiqued for one-dimensional heroes.

Playing Superman is no small featā€”Cavill had to embody not just the strength and invulnerability of the character but also the sense of alienation, responsibility, and hope that Superman represents. As Bond, Cavill would similarly need to bring both physicality and emotional depth to the role. Bond is not just a cool, calm, and collected spyā€”heā€™s a man torn between duty, loyalty, and personal conflict. Cavill, with his experience of playing a larger-than-life hero who still struggles with personal issues, could easily translate these complexities into his version of Bond.

Geralt of Rivia: Cavillā€™s Gritty, Stoic Anti-Hero in The Witcher

Cavillā€™s role as Geralt in The Witcher on Netflix demonstrated a completely different side of his acting range. Geralt is a gruff, battle-hardened monster hunter who speaks little but conveys a lot through subtle body language, facial expressions, and intense, action-filled fight scenes. Geraltā€™s stoic nature, moral dilemmas, and complex personality could mirror some aspects of Bond.

What makes Cavillā€™s Geralt special is his ability to show tenderness amid stoicism, much like Bond, who often hides his vulnerability behind a tough exterior. Moreover, Cavillā€™s dedication to the role (even performing many of his own stunts) shows his commitment to giving fans an authentic portrayal. This commitment would serve him well if he were to take on the rigorous physical demands of James Bond.

The Challenges of Playing Bond: Cavill's Stunt Experience and Physicality

Physical Demands: Is Cavill Ready for the Role?

One of the most significant challenges Cavill would face as Bond is the sheer physicality of the role. James Bond is no stranger to hand-to-hand combat, dangerous stunts, and high-speed chases. While Cavill has had his fair share of action-heavy roles, being Bond comes with its own unique demands.

In Mission: Impossible ā€“ Fallout, Cavill impressed audiences with his fight scenes alongside Tom Cruise, including the now-iconic bathroom brawl. His towering presence and impressive physique made him a force to be reckoned with, but Bondā€™s fight choreography leans more toward finesse and style rather than brute strength. Cavill may need to tone down his physical approach, opting for Bondā€™s signature mix of elegance and lethality in combat.

Additionally, the world of Bond is filled with elaborate stunts, often pushing the lead actor to their physical limits. Daniel Craig famously sustained numerous injuries during his tenure as Bond, including knee surgeries and facial cuts. Cavillā€™s experience performing his stunts as Geralt and Superman shows heā€™s up to the challenge, but the toll of a multi-film Bond contract could be grueling. Would Cavill be willing to commit his body and time to such a demanding role over several years?

The Accent Dilemma: Can Henry Cavill Balance British Elegance and American Appeal?

One of the key aspects of James Bond is his British identity. From Sean Conneryā€™s Scottish charm to Craigā€™s tough yet sophisticated English demeanor, Bond has always been an embodiment of British cool. Cavill, while British, is more globally recognized for playing Superman, an iconic American hero.

Transitioning from his American roles back to his natural British accent might not be a problem for Cavill, but heā€™ll need to ensure that he strikes the right balance between the traditional Bond and his own unique spin. Cavill has shown he can handle period British charm in The Man from U.N.C.L.E., where he played an American CIA agent with Bond-like sophistication, but for Bond, it needs to be seamless.

The Cultural Impact: Henry Cavill as a Modern James Bond

A New Face for a New Generation

If Cavill were to take on the role of James Bond, it would mark a shift not just in the actor playing the character but in what Bond represents to modern audiences. Cavill has already cultivated a massive fan base across various demographics, from DC die-hards to The Witcher fans. His casting as Bond would undoubtedly bring a fresh wave of attention to the franchise, especially from younger audiences who have grown up with his portrayal of Superman.

Cavillā€™s global appeal, particularly in America, would also help boost the franchise's appeal internationally. However, some purists might question whether Cavillā€™s modern-day stardom could overshadow the traditional, somewhat mysterious nature of Bond. Would Cavill be seen as Henry Cavill playing James Bond, or could he successfully disappear into the role?

Redefining Bond for the Future

The James Bond franchise has been evolving with the times, especially during Daniel Craigā€™s era, which leaned into a more vulnerable and morally complex version of the character. With conversations around diversity, inclusion, and the future of the franchise, Cavillā€™s casting could represent a continuation of this modernization. Cavill, who is known for his earnest approach to his characters, could bring a new emotional depth to Bond, making him less of a playboy and more of a grounded hero.

While some fans have voiced a desire for a Bond who breaks from traditionā€”a woman, or perhaps a Bond of colorā€”Cavill represents a safer, but still appealing, choice. His charisma, physical presence, and established fame make him an ideal candidate, but thereā€™s no denying that his casting would signify a more conservative step forward for the franchise. However, Cavillā€™s Bond could still carry the potential for reinvention, with the right script and direction.

Cavillā€™s Suitability: Fitting the Bond Archetype

Bondā€™s Style and Sophistication: Can Henry Cavill Pull It Off?

Thereā€™s no doubt that Henry Cavill can wear a suit. Whether itā€™s his impeccable looks on red carpets or his portrayal of suave agents in The Man from U.N.C.L.E., Cavill has proven time and again that he has the sartorial elegance needed for James Bond. Bondā€™s style is more than just clothing; itā€™s an attitude, a way of moving through the world. Cavillā€™s cool confidence, honed through years of playing sophisticated characters, positions him well for this aspect of the role.

However, Bondā€™s charm isnā€™t just about looksā€”itā€™s about wit and intelligence. Cavill has demonstrated in roles like Geralt that he can handle more than just brooding looks and physicality; he has a subtle sense of humor that could blend well with Bondā€™s classic quips. The challenge, however, would be ensuring that Cavill doesnā€™t lean too heavily on the "tough guy" persona, as Bond requires a more refined kind of toughness, one that isnā€™t all muscle but also tactical wit and intellectual prowess.

Standing Tall: Cavillā€™s Height and the Bond Formula

At 6'1", Henry Cavill is taller than most of the previous Bonds, with the exception of Roger Moore. While this may seem trivial, Bondā€™s height and physicality are key elements of his allure. Cavillā€™s imposing stature gives him a natural advantage in action sequences, but it could be a challenge to capture Bondā€™s more understated moments of subtle seduction and charm.
